SYNONYMY


Taxonomic Comments.   This species is very similar to Phloeotribus dentifrons (Blackman) and is probably conspecific.


  • Phthorophloeus texanus (Schaeffer 1908) J. N.Y. Ent. Soc. 16: 222
  • Phloeotribus texanus Schaeffer 1908. J. N.Y. Ent. Soc. 16: 222

Distribution Comments.   This species is found in eastern North America, through Texas and into the lower elevations of northeastern Mexico. It is also found in the southwestern U.S. (Arizona) and adjacent parts of Mexico as far south as Jalisco on the pacific coast. Further sampling in central Mexico would likely extend it's known range.
